Extending Soya Bean and Cottonseed Oils Shelf‐Lifes by Blending Them With Palm Kernel Oil During Frying of Potato Chips

open access: yesFuture Postharvest and Food, Volume 3, Issue 2, Page 234-250, June 2026.
Blending soya bean and cottonseed oils with palm kernel oil at ratios 50:50, 40:60, and 30:70 significantly increase their oxidative stability during frying of potato chips compared to soya bean oil and cottonseed oil alone. Biodiesel Production From Canola Oil by Titanium Dioxide‐Photocatalysed Transesterification

open access: yesGCB Bioenergy, Volume 18, Issue 6, June 2026.
Photocatalytic transesterification of canola oil over TiO2 under UVA irradiation enables biodiesel production under mild conditions. Yields up to 73% FAME and 38% FAEE were achieved, with negative Gibbs free energy (ΔG < 0) confirming thermodynamic favourability.
